Course details

• Introduction to Cybersecurity Incident Response
• Understanding Small Business Cybersecurity Threats
• Developing a Cybersecurity Incident Response Plan
• Implementing Cybersecurity Best Practices for Small Businesses
• Identifying and Responding to Cybersecurity Incidents
• Cybersecurity Incident Reporting and Documentation
• Post-Incident Response: Recovery and Improvement
• Legal and Regulatory Considerations in Cybersecurity Incident Response
• Cybersecurity Awareness and Training for Small Business Employees
• Case Studies: Real-World Cybersecurity Incident Response Scenarios
